Before you add a treehouse in your child's room it is important to ensure that it's safe and secure. This is why you should consult an arborist or someone with similar expertise before you begin construction. They can tell you if the existing tree is strong enough to support the structure and provide advice on what kind of support will be required.

In general, it's recommended to keep the structure as lightweight as you can so that you won't place too much stress on the tree. The heavier your treehouse carries the more support it'll require and the more potential damage it can cause. If you plan on adding furniture or other heavy objects, it's best to choose a sturdy platform constructed of deck boards made from plywood. You can build it using cedar or other durable materials for a more complex build. You will also want to construct a railing, and if possible, have a ladder or staircase attached for security.
